Forgetting your Netgear router password can be frustrating, but fear not, you can easily retrieve it using a few simple methods. Here's how:

  1. Check the router label: Most Netgear routers have a default username and password printed on a label stuck on the router itself. Look for this label on the bottom or back of your router.
  2. Login to the router's web interface: Open a web browser and enter your router's IP address in the address bar. You will be prompted to enter a username and password. If you haven't changed it, the default login credentials can be found in the router manual or the Netgear website.
  3. Reset the router: If all else fails, you can reset your Netgear router to its factory settings. This will erase all custom settings, including your password. To do this, press and hold the reset button on the back of the router for about 10 seconds.

Remember to set a strong, unique password after retrieving your Netgear router password to ensure the security of your network.
